Adds log compaction to Quarlmesh broker segments. Compaction runs per-partition, keyed on message ID, and skips segments younger than the retention floor. Tested against the Dunmore staging cluster at 3x normal ingest; disk usage dropped roughly 40% with no consumer-visible gaps. Flagged off by default; enable via broker config. No migration needed. Safe to include in the Harlock release. Default tuning constants are defined below.

constants for bawif-kawif:
QUOTAS = {
    "ulaael": 5,
    "holael": 10,
}

**Checklist item: Fieldnook offline mode.** Plugin authors, make sure your extensions queue writes through the Fieldnook sync buffer instead of hitting storage directly — anything that bypasses it will vanish when connectivity drops mid-survey. Test with airplane mode toggled during a form save, and confirm your conflict handlers fire on reconnect. The offline-certified build is identified by the token below.

build token for tawip-yageg: htk9_92ac43d42

# Consent Banner Rollout — On-call Notes

The Lantry consent banner is rolling out region by region via the FlagDeck gates. Current stage: 40% in the Orvale region. If consent-rate dashboards drop sharply or the banner double-fires, kill the gate — don't debug live. Rollback is instant; user consent records are append-only so nothing is lost. Escalate only if the consent-write queue backs up past 10k. The FlagDeck gate API requires the on-call service key, provided below.

app token of tadug-yahag = vxb3-949

Subject: Budget Request — Branch Refurbishment Programme

Dear Executive Team,

On behalf of the branch managers of Caldermont Savings, I am submitting a consolidated budget request for the refurbishment of six regional branches. The figures reflect contractor quotes gathered last month and include a 10% contingency. Approval this quarter would let works begin before the winter slowdown. The confidential rationale is appended directly below.

management briefing: Project Ulavan slips by two quarters because of the staffing delay.

**Q: Where has the mail room gone, and how do we get in?**

As of this week, the mail room has relocated from Level 1 to the Ostler Annex, beside goods-in. The former room is decommissioned; do not store post there under any circumstances. Couriers should be directed to the annex shutter. Facilities desk staff can open the new room using the code below.

turnstile pass: bdg-QZV-3